What interim monitoring truly indicates in a Magnet setting
Interim monitoring is best comprehended as an organized way to verify that the designation effort stays accurate, current, and defensible in time. It is not simply a development conference. It is a disciplined evaluation of whether the evidence a company plans to present still shows real practice, real leadership structures, and actual empirical outcomes.
That distinction ends up being crucial really quickly. A healthcare facility may have done exceptional preparatory work, mapped evidence to Sources of Evidence requirements, and designated material owners for each area of the composed paperwork. Then management changes. A service line restructures. A council charter is modified. Outcome patterns enhance in one location and degrade in another. If nobody notices those changes early enough, the last submission can become a patchwork of out-of-date story and insufficient information logic.
Experienced Magnet ® Consulting teams tend to look for precisely that issue. They understand the issue is hardly ever effort. More often, it is drift. Individuals presume the structure is steady due to the fact that the project plan exists. In reality, classification work is vibrant. If the organization is progressing, the designation story must develop with it.
The authorities Magnet framework helps describe why. The present empirical design is organized around five elements: Transformational Leadership; Structural Empowerment; Exemplary Professional Practice; New Understanding, Innovations, & & Improvements; and Empirical Outcomes. These are not separated chapters. They connect. A change in management structure can impact professional practice. An innovation initiative can shape results. A council redesign can affect structural empowerment and empirical reporting. Interim monitoring offers teams a structured opportunity to see those linkages before they become inconsistencies.

What needs to be monitored, regularly and without drama
A useful tracking procedure does not require to be theatrical. In fact, the calmer it is, the much better it typically works. The point is not to develop a consistent sense of audit. The point is to maintain confidence that the designation file remains accurate and coherent.
Most companies gain from routine review in a few core areas:
- alignment of current organizational structures with the composed classification narrative
- status of evidence tied to Sources of Proof requirements in the Application Manual
- integrity and instructions of empirical results over time
- ownership and timelines for updates, modifications, and approvals
- readiness to use ANCC tools and assistance properly throughout the appraisal process
Those categories sound uncomplicated, but each has useful intricacy. Structural alignment, for instance, is not almost an organizational chart. It consists of councils, management roles, shared decision-making mechanisms, and the practical way nursing impact appears in the organization. If those structures modification, the narrative needs to alter with them.
Evidence status sounds administrative, yet it typically exposes deeper issues. Teams might discover that a flagship example is convincing in discussion but inadequately recorded. Or they might recognize 2 different sections are utilizing the exact same story to show various points, which can weaken both if not handled thoughtfully. Keeping track of catches duplication, weak linkage, and stale examples before they end up being bigger problems.

Empirical results require specific care since they sit at the heart of trustworthiness. ANCC's design includes Empirical Results as one of its 5 core parts for a reason. Acknowledgment for nursing quality can not rest on narrative alone. Throughout interim monitoring, organizations need to keep asking a disciplined question: does the outcome story stay clear, present, and constant with the broader evidence existing? That is not a data vanity workout. It is a dependability exercise.
The five-component design is not simply a structure, it is a monitoring lens
The current Magnet design did not appear by mishap. ANCC's model evolved from the earlier 14 Forces of Magnetism after analytical analysis of appraisal scores, and the 2008 conceptual design grouped those forces into the 5 elements used today. For consulting work, that evolution matters because it advises groups to believe in incorporated systems rather than separated examples.
Interim monitoring works best when every review asks how the proof still shows those 5 elements in a balanced method. A company can be tempted to lean too heavily on visible leadership stories because they are much easier to tell. Another might count on structural examples and underplay improvements and innovations. A third may have excellent result reports but weak expression of how professional practice supports those results.
The five components offer a useful restorative. They assist groups evaluate whether the classification story is in proportion. If Transformational Management is strong, can the company likewise demonstrate how that management translated into empowerment and practice? If there is an innovation story under New Understanding, Innovations, & & Improvements, is it merely fascinating, or is it integrated into care and linked to outcomes? If Structural Empowerment is described as a strength, do the structures still exist in the exact same type and function declared in the documentation?
These are keeping an eye on concerns, not simply writing concerns. That is an essential difference. A narrative can sound sleek while hiding weak alignment beneath the surface. Interim evaluation is the moment to inspect compound before style hardens around out-of-date assumptions.
Written documentation is where lots of organizations either tighten up or lose ground
ANCC needs composed documentation tied to evidence requirements in the Application Manual, typically gone over through Sources of Evidence and related crosswalk products. That means the composed submission is not a broad essay about organizational culture. It is a precise body of proof. During classification, interim tracking ought to continuously ask whether the evidence stays present and whether the document still reflects how the organization actually operates.
This is where an experienced author's discipline ends up being useful. Strong paperwork generally has 3 qualities. It is precise, selective, and internally constant. Accuracy means every declaration can be safeguarded. Selectivity means the organization selects examples that bring real weight instead of attempting to consist of whatever. Internal consistency means a claim made in one area does not quietly contradict another section.
A typical failure point is over-collection. Groups gather mountains of product due to the fact that they fear leaving something out. Six months later on, they are buried in examples, variations, accessories, and old files. Interim tracking needs to lower, not expand, confusion. If the procedure is healthy, each evaluation leaves the group clearer about which evidence still matters and which evidence needs to be retired.
I when saw a nursing leadership team invest a whole afternoon discussing whether to protect a beloved anecdote in a draft area. It was significant to the people in the room, and it represented a real moment of development. The issue was that it no longer matched the existing structure being described. Keeping it would have introduced confusion. Removing it felt agonizing, however it reinforced the final story. That is what reliable monitoring often appears like, less romantic than people anticipate, more editorial than ceremonial.

Designation is not redesignation, and the tracking mindset should show that
ANCC distinguishes between designation and redesignation. Organizations that have currently earned Magnet Recognition pursue redesignation to continue being acknowledged. That difference matters due to the fact that interim monitoring should fit the organization's stage.
A first-time applicant often requires monitoring that emphasizes build, positioning, and evidence of maturity. The group might still be discovering how to equate exceptional nursing practice into Magnet-ready paperwork. A redesignation effort, by contrast, might need more scrutiny of continuity, sustainment, and development. The obstacle there is typically not whether structures exist, however whether they have been kept, strengthened, and showed honestly over time.

Consulting support ought to not flatten those differences. A skilled adviser understands that a novice classification team might need more help developing file governance and proof choice discipline, while a redesignation group may require sharper analysis of what has actually really advanced since the previous acknowledgment duration. The monitoring cadence, conversation design, and review priorities can all shift based on that context.
A useful rhythm for monitoring
Interim tracking works best when it is routine enough to catch drift and focused enough to produce decisions. It needs to not become a vast meeting where everybody reports whatever they understand. The much better design is a disciplined review cycle with clear owners, current materials, and particular follow-up.
A useful checkpoint typically responds to a short set of concerns:
- what altered since the last review
- what evidence or narrative now needs revision
- what stays strong and stable
- what is at danger if left untouched
- who owns the next action and by when
That structure keeps the conversation operational. It also minimizes a common temptation, which is to utilize Magnet meetings as broad online forums for organizational storytelling. Storytelling has worth, but keeping track of meetings require to produce decisions. Otherwise the team leaves feeling hectic and accomplished while the actual paperwork remains untouched.
One practical indication of a healthy process is version control. Not the software application side, however the behavioral side. Everyone should know which draft is present, who can modify it, and how changes are approved. Another sign is that leaders do not wait to surface issues. If an empirical pattern softens, if a structural change affects a narrative area, or if an example no longer fits, the issue must come forward instantly. Excellent tracking decreases defensiveness. It makes revision feel typical instead of embarrassing.
